I keep getting this

test1# man
/usr/libexec/ld-elf.so.1: Cannot open "/usr/lib/libz.so.2"
test1#
test1#
test1#
test1#
test1# ls -l /usr/lib/libz*
-r--r--r--  1 root  wheel  59810 Sep 18 17:25 /usr/lib/libz.a
lrwxrwxrwx  1 root  wheel      9 Oct  1 17:28 /usr/lib/libz.so -> libz.so.2
-r--r--r--  1 root  wheel  50748 Sep 18 17:25 /usr/lib/libz.so.2
-r--r--r--  1 root  wheel  63912 Sep 18 17:25 /usr/lib/libz_p.a


after doing an automated install via netboot/nfs (Intel PXE).  Any ideas 
on how to fix?  I'm doing the 'setKernDeveloper' in install.cfg, but 
I've also tried other distributions, including custom, all with the same 
result.
